/**
* Add months to the instance. Positive $value travels forward while
* negative $value travels into the past.
*
* When adding or subtracting months, if the resulting time is a date
* that does not exist, the result of this operation will always be the
* last day of the intended month.
*
* ### Example:
*
* ```
* (new Chronos('2015-01-03'))->addMonths(1); // Results in 2015-02-03
*
* (new Chronos('2015-01-31'))->addMonths(1); // Results in 2015-02-28
* ```
*
* @param int $value The number of months to add.
* @return static
*/
public function addMonths($value);

/**
* Get the difference in a human readable format in the current locale.
*
* When comparing a value in the past to default now:
* 1 hour ago
* 5 months ago
*
* When comparing a value in the future to default now:
* 1 hour from now
* 5 months from now
*
* When comparing a value in the past to another value:
* 1 hour before
* 5 months before
*
* When comparing a value in the future to another value:
* 1 hour after
* 5 months after
*
* @param \Cake\Chronos\ChronosInterface|null $other The datetime to compare with.
* @param bool $absolute Removes time difference modifiers ago, after, etc
* @return string
*/
public function diffForHumans(ChronosInterface $other = null, $absolute = false);
